Sign In — Free (10 views/day)Highland District Council on Aging Inc Highland Senior Center, founded in 1979, is a small nonprofit in the Human Services sector that reported $920K in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ue surged 94%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. The organization ran a surplus of $445K, a strong 48% operating margin.
The mission of the Highland Senior Center is to enrich, maintain, and protect the quality of life of senior adults.
